***Incoming Message***
***Comm ID: Andrew Mort***
***Location: Alcatraz depot***


Greetings fellow rogues and allies, these days in Liberty core systems are getting rather messy with the more larger ships, which, are starting to interfere with our and our allies operations. Right now the gathered data is analyzed. The navy and police are starting to use big ships, my friends...we must show that that might be a big mistake. These few targets are the more common around liberty, usually paroling the core systems without little to no anti bomber protection.

Sitting ducks.

These ships while a target for assassin wings because of their active interference with our work, also offer a very large amount of goods, that are vital to our bases within these areas, mainly Alcatraz and Buffalo.

All available intel on these ships are added in the file below:



////Adding component
////Decrypting
////Opening



///Target id: a7g83g

Target name: LNS Thunderbolt
Ship class: Liberty Carrier
Area: Liberty core systems
Danger level: low
Individual bounty: No

[Image: thunder.png]

Reason: Active engagement of rogue and outcast patrols around Jersey scrap field, Badlands, reports show this ship sighted dangerously near Alcatraz depot and the ice field around it.

Additional intel: This ship is sighted rather frequently in New York, usually unprotected and vulnerable, but it proposes large threat for any active raids and is fond to be a resupply point of the LN and LPI ships.



///Target id: b32k52

Target name: LNS WarMachene
Ship class: Liberty Battle Cruiser
Area: New York, Texas
Danger level: Medium
Individual bounty: No

[Image: warmachene.png]

Reason: Active engagement of patrols around liberty, admiral is rumored to be unstable. Sighted near Beaumont base, engaging Junker and Rogue patrols, destroying and disrupting smuggler ships.

Additional intel: Admiral seems to be trigger happy, hostile to anything that is not an LNS, does not seem to obey order.

///Adding file
[Image: warmechen.png]
[Image: warmechen2.png]


////Closing Component


These ships are a large threat of not only Rogues, Outcasts and Hackers, but junkers and other smuggler vessels alike. Allie scouts are welcome to add their data to this list and recent sightings.


Andrew Mort



***End Transmission***
